Output ec63a044959abce417a7a58d5bf52e964b39bb0c560de0ffb6d8c14bf7700a97:1

value
4266803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f75e92d1dd1f740da534e9b2c70926121b4d414 OP_EQUAL
address
3DJxzVgYd8TpWPGE61jPUNCPBCdcVYjMch
transaction
ec63a044959abce417a7a58d5bf52e964b39bb0c560de0ffb6d8c14bf7700a97
spent
true